We ordered chicken feet, rose chicken, onion crispy chicken, pork belly and beef bone soup — and overall it was a really satisfying Korean comfort meal. The **rose chicken** was the highlight. The sauce was creamy with a mild spicy kick and a subtle rose flavour, which sounds unusual but actually worked really well. It also came with sausage and rice cakes, making it very hearty and perfect with rice. The **onion crispy chicken** was super crispy — one of the crispiest fried chickens we've had. The sweet onion topping balanced the crunch nicely without being too heavy. The **chicken feet** were flavourful and spicy, great for those who enjoy something with a bit of heat and strong Korean-style seasoning. The **pork belly** was well cooked and tender, and paired nicely with the other dishes. The **beef bone soup** was comforting and rich, with a clean flavour that balanced out the heavier fried and spicy dishes. Overall, generous portions, bold flavours, and great for sharing. Would definitely come back again with friends. 👍
